I have a Bamboo (not a Fun) at work. Whenever IT does a system download the computer "forgets" where to find the tablet details and reverts back to "mouse" mode and thoroughly confuses me. All I need to do is reboot and it is OK.

 

If it's not some higher being messing with your mind :twisted: ...

 

Look in your "All Programmes" for a "Pen Tablet" sub-menu then "Pen Tablet Properties" under that. (This is on my Vista machine... it should be something similar)

 

On the "Pen" tab, make sure that "Tracking" is set to "Pen Mode", not "Mouse Mode".

 

If that doesn't fix it, you may need to uninstall and reinstall.
